Description

This Knightsbridge pull cord dimmer switch uses trailing-edge dimming technology to control loads from 10-150W for incandescent bulbs or 5-100W for LED lamps. The 75mm diameter matt white ceiling rose houses the dimmer electronics, with a 1.5m white braided pull cord and a conical white pull tip for operation. The switch is wired as a 1-way circuit, meaning it controls a single light fitting from one location.

Designed for bathrooms, utility rooms and attic spaces where cord-operated controls are preferred or required under building regulations, the dimmer uses a pull-on/pull-off action for switching and a pull-and-hold operation for dimming up or down. A built-in potentiometer on the dimmer module allows the dimming curve to be adjusted during installation to eliminate flicker with specific lamp types, improving compatibility across LED and incandescent light sources.

The 36mm-deep ceiling rose is constructed from premium-grade steel with an ABS fascia in a matt white finish. The IP20 rating limits installation to dry indoor locations only. The switch is certified to EN 60669-2 and carries Class II double-insulated wiring, so no earth connection is required. The 1.5m cord length suits ceiling heights between 2.4-2.7m, allowing the pull tip to hang at a comfortable reach height of approximately 1.8-2m from the floor.

Frequently Asked

What's the difference between trailing-edge and leading-edge dimming?

Trailing-edge dimmers switch off the AC waveform at the end of each cycle rather than the start, making them better suited to LED and electronic transformer loads. Leading-edge dimmers work well with incandescent and magnetic transformer loads but can cause flickering or buzzing with LEDs.

Will this work with my LED bulbs?

The dimmer supports LED loads between 5-100W total. Compatibility depends on the specific LED lamp — check with the lamp manufacturer that their product is rated as dimmable and compatible with trailing-edge dimmers. The built-in potentiometer can be adjusted to fine-tune performance and reduce flicker with different lamp types.

Can this be installed in a bathroom?

Yes, but only in zones where IP20-rated equipment is permitted under BS 7671 wiring regulations. The switch is suitable outside bathroom zones 0, 1 and 2, typically meaning installation on a ceiling at least 2.25m from a bath or shower tray. Consult a qualified electrician for confirmation on your specific installation.

What does 1-way mean?

1-way means the dimmer controls a single light fitting from one location only. If you need to control the same light from two different positions (e.g. top and bottom of stairs), you would need a 2-way dimmer circuit instead.
